🧰Accessories for a English Bulldog: harness, bowls and essentials

English Bulldog : A wide harness designed for deep chests (30-60 €), fold-cleaning wipes, a cooling mat and a flotation vest near water: the English Bulldog can barely swim at all. A ramp for the sofa or car spares its joints.

In short: Stocky medium dog, 31-40 cm at the withers (18-25 kg), smooth coat, very short muzzle, low energy level. A placid, stubborn, endearing dog with a low, massive frame and little taste for exertion. Its many skin folds (face, nose, tail) need near-daily cleaning and drying to prevent moisture build-up and infection: fold wipes are a staple consumable.

Harness and lead sized for the English Bulldog

For its 18 to 25 kg, pick a Y-fit harness in size M to L, two-point adjustable and ideally tried on: a good fit lets two fingers slide everywhere without slack. A 2-metre lead in town and a longer one for strolls match its steady pace.

Bowls and daily kit

A wide, shallow bowl for its short muzzle — slow-feed version if it inhales its food. Complete the set with an always-full water point, a mat under the bowls and an airtight bin for the kibble.

Frequently asked questions

What harness size for a English Bulldog?

Size M to L for an adult of 18 to 25 kg, in an adjustable Y-cut — measure the girth behind the elbows to decide between two sizes.

What starter budget for a English Bulldog?

Expect €150 to 300 for the full kit (bed, harness and lead, bowls, crate, toys, brush), food excluded.
